Punch in a bunch of equations, look at the graph and equations and draw some conclusions. Type in x^2 in the calculator ( desmos.come) and hit enter. This is your standard function, the square function. Now punch in each of the following equations. x^2+2 x^2+5 x^2+7 x^2-2 x^2-4 x^2-4 x^2-8 x^2-1 x^2+1 Do not punch in y = x^2 + 2 , just punch in the x^2 +2 . Look for pattern. What is happening to each parabola??? Why ??? Draw some conclusions ?
